Understanding Game Selection and Variance
A fundamental strategy for success in any casino, be it physical or online, is astute game selection. Not all games are created equal; they possess varying house edges and levels of volatility, often referred to as variance. Games like blackjack and video poker, when played with optimal strategy, offer some of the lowest house edges, meaning players have a better chance of winning over the long term. However, even with a low house edge, short-term results can be unpredictable due to variance. Variance describes the fluctuation in outcomes; high-variance games offer larger potential payouts but with less frequent wins, while low-variance games provide more consistent, albeit smaller, wins. Choosing games that align with your risk tolerance and bankroll is paramount. Someone with a smaller bankroll might prefer lower-variance slots or table games, while a player with a more substantial bankroll might be willing to take on the higher risk of high-variance options.
The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)
Closely related to house edge is the concept of Return to Player (RTP). RTP is a theoretical percentage that indicates how much of all wagered money a game will pay back to players over a long period. A game with an RTP of 96% will, on average, return $96 for every $100 wagered. While RTP doesn't guarantee a win in any individual session, it's a useful metric for comparing games and identifying those that offer the most favorable odds. Reputable online casinos typically publish the RTP for each of their games, allowing players to make informed decisions. It's important to remember that RTP is a long-term average, and your individual results may vary significantly. Always research the RTP before committing to a particular game.

Bankroll Management Strategies
Perhaps the most crucial aspect of successful casino gaming is effective bankroll management. This involves setting a specific budget for your gambling activities and adhering to it strictly. A common guideline is to only gamble with money you can afford to lose, as losses are an inherent part of the process. Before you even begin playing, determine the maximum amount you're willing to risk and never exceed that limit. Within that bankroll, further segment your funds based on the types of games you'll be playing and the size of your bets.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ly lead to depleting your entire bankroll. If you experience a losing streak, resist the urge to increase your bets in an attempt to recoup your losses; instead, take a break and reassess your strategy.
Utilizing the Unit System
A useful tool for bankroll management is the unit system. A unit represents a small percentage of your total bankroll, typically 1% to 5%. The size of your bet is then expressed in terms of units. For example, if your bankroll is $1000 and you define a unit as 2%, your unit size is $20. You would then bet a specified number of units on each game. This approach helps you to control your bet sizes and prevent significant losses. When you are winning, you can incrementally increase the size of your units, but always remain within the confines of your overall bankroll. When losing, reduce your unit size to preserve capital. This disciplined approach protects against volatility.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Game Weighting
Wagering requirements are typically exp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Game weighting refers to how much each game contributes tow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ette may contribute only 10% or 20%. Effectively utilizing bonuses involves choosing games that contribute fully towards the wagering requirements and carefully tracking your progress to ensure you meet the terms and conditions before attempting to withdraw your winnings.
